Offering 39 rooms, the comfortable Hotel Therese Paris is near the entertainment district of Paris, around 25 minutes' walk from the Pont Alexandre III. The Musée d'Orsay is located not far from this 4-star smoke-free hotel, boasting a lounge bar and courtyard views.
Location
Situated in the very heart of Paris, the hotel is merely 0.6 km from Louvre Museum. Guests can visit the Buren Columns, which is nearly a 5-minute walk away, and the Quai Branly Museum which is approximately 10 minutes' drive from the Therese Paris. Feel in total harmony with nature by visiting the Champ de Mars, 3.4 km from the property.
This Paris hotel stands within 10 minutes' walk of Pyramides tube station and within a few blocks of Auber train station.
Rooms
The rooms at the Therese have high-speed internet and a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, along with a mini-bar for your convenience. Climate control are featured for guests' comfort. Private bathrooms include nice touches such as hair dryers and shower caps.
